About the role

Gilmerton Care Home, located in the peaceful south of Edinburgh, offers exceptional residential, nursing, dementia, and respite care. Our home provides a warm, family-like environment with modern, comfortable living spaces, engaging activities, and personalised care plans. Joining our team means working in a supportive setting where residents’ well-being is at the heart of everything we do, and where staff are valued, trained, and given opportunities to develop their careers. Chef Contract 14.58 per hour Contracted to 30 hours per week Paid PVG, pension and uniform provided 5.6 weeks annual leave (based on a full time contract) Why Join Gilmerton Care Home? Great food is an important part of daily life, bringing comfort, familiarity and enjoyment, and as a Chef, you will play an important role in creating meals that residents genuinely look forward to each day. Working closely with the wider kitchen team, you will prepare and serve high quality meals that are both nutritious and tailored to individual dietary needs. From supporting menu planning and food preparation to maintaining excellent food hygiene standards and ensuring the kitchen operates smoothly, your work will directly contribute to the wellbeing and overall experience of residents within the home. This is an excellent opportunity for someone who takes pride in preparing quality meals, enjoys working in a busy kitchen environment and understands the important role food plays in creating positive daily experiences. Every meal served is an opportunity to provide comfort, consistency and something residents can truly enjoy. What Matters Most Previous experience working within a professional kitchen environment is essential Food Hygiene certification or understanding of food safety standards is beneficial Ability to work independently while supporting the wider kitchen team Good organisation skills with ability to manage food preparation and maintain high standards Reliable, professional and hardworking approach with genuine passion for quality food preparation If you are looking for a role where your culinary skills help create comfort, quality and positive experiences every day, this could be the perfect opportunity for you.
